    An XDK is an XDK is an XDK.

    They all do the same thing. The E is a bad way to go about an XDK anyhow seeing as it's a stripped S and no way to put a sidecar on them. The XDK E is rare because of the end of life time the 360 was in and never made it out to developers. The ones popping up were internal stress kits with only that function in mind.

    But for functionality, an S is far superior in my opinion.
